70% to 80% of the kaolin produced in China is used for ceramics and refractory materials. Most of them use raw ore directly, and low-grade refractory materials. Suzhou Suzhou Kaolin Mine is a soft kaolin with high grade and can be directly used in industry. Its hand No. 1 mud is more than 10 times higher than the hand No. 4 mud. Therefore, it is required to protect high quality soil during mining and protect the purity of the original ore. In order to make it not to be crumb-like, in the past, many manual mining and mining were carried out on the mining face. Now the mining scale is large, but in order to connect with the hand-selected factory, it is still necessary to pay attention to the selection. The raw ore price of kaolin is quite different. For example, the original ore price of kaolin in Suzhou is 230 yuan/t, the original ore price of Fujian Longyan Kaolin Company is 90 yuan/t, and the original ore price of Qingshan white mud mine in Wuxian is 203.5 yuan/t. China's kaolin mining methods and mining scales Kaolin mining methods are open pit mining and underground mining. Weathered residual kaolin mines are open-pit mining, such as Maoming's sandy kaolin. Other hydrothermal alterations and sedimentary deposits are used for open pit mining and deep underground mining.
There are many mining sites using open pit mining, but most of them are small and medium-sized mines. The large ones include Fujian Longyan Kaolin Company, Guangdong Maoming Kaolin Company, and Guangdong Maoming Southern Kaolin Company. Open-pit mining has been used in the Yangxi mining area and the Yangdong mining area of ​​the former Suzhou China Kaolin Company. The scale of underground mining is: Jiangsu Yangxi shaft, Guanshan shaft, Baishanling mine in Yangdong and Qingshan white mud mine in Wuxian.
The division of mining scale uses two methods: one is based on the amount of ore; the other is based on the amount of concentrate, China's kaolin development and transportation.
Haulage open-pit mining of kaolin ore is used more three kinds: one for narrow roads and rail iron forge, with 7t, or 10t, 14t motor vehicle or traction 1m3 tub. The open-pit mining of Yangdong and Yangxi, formerly owned by Suzhou China Kaolin Company, has been used. The second is to use the sand pump to carry out hydraulic transportation with the water gun. The slurry is transported from the slurry tank located in the ore block to the selected plants, such as Guangdong Maoming Kaolin Company and Guangdong Maoming Southern Kaolin Company. Third, the road to develop automobile transportation, such as the Longyan kaolin mine in Fujian, is a weathered residual kaolin mineral kaolin, but because the water resources are not abundant, it is still developed by the general open-pit mining method, and the ore is taken from the mining face by the 17t dump truck. transported to the beneficiation plant. Another example is Guangdong Chaozhou Feitian Yanchong Mine, which also uses roads to develop automobile transportation.
The development of underground mining is divided according to the type of main roadway: First, the shaft is developed. For example, the Yangxi shaft of Suzhou China Kaolin Company is the lower shaft. The Guanshan mine under construction is the upper shaft; Wuxian Qingshanbai The deep mining of the mud mine is the use of the lower shaft. The second is the development of inclined wells. For example, the original Yangxi main inclined shaft project of Suzhou China Kaolin Company uses the inclined shaft of the chassis; the shallow mining of Qingshan Baimu Mine in Wu County also uses the inclined shaft of the chassis. The third is joint development. For example, the Yangshan Baishan Lingding, owned by Suzhou China Kaolin Company, is jointly developed by Pingyi-Blind Diagonal Well.
The main transportation roadway for underground mining is usually located in the bottom plate, 20-40m away from the ore body. The side of the ore body is provided with a ventilation inclined shaft to form a diagonal ventilation system. The stage height is generally 25~40m. The kaolin mine in the underground mining project has great speciality. The ore firmness coefficient f=1~2, soft and brittle, plasticity, plasticity index in natural state, water absorption and swelling after water contact. It also has water-tightness and is a typical plastic medium, which is a plastomer. Underground mining activities are basically carried out in the plastic zone and the plastic zone. The ground pressure characteristics of the roadway after excavation in the ore body. 1) The surrounding rock has a large amount of deformation and rheological properties. For example, the underground mine of Suzhou China Kaolin Company, the stope is supported by a partitioned wooden shed, the section is 1.6m×1.8m, the spacing of the wooden shed is 0.6~0.8m, and the subsidence of the roof of 7~12d is 50~60cm, almost 7~15d. It will need to be renovated once. It is required to support the roadway immediately after excavation.
2) In the deformation activity, it is accompanied by volume expansion due to the water absorption property of kaolin. As its water content continues to increase, it also causes its physical state changes, from solid to semi-solid, and has been fragmented. Therefore, in addition to plasticity, it has the characteristics of "loose". 3) The kaolinite ore body contains montmorillonite, and the montmorillonite is easy to swell after water absorption. In the deformation of kaolin, there is also the influence of smectite water swelling, and the content of montmorillonite should be emphasized. 4) The influence of stope dynamic pressure on the lower mining lane can be ignored. The local action of dynamic pressure is often consumed by the deformation of kaolin without being transmitted.
The inner roadway should be closed and supported. According to the elastoplastic theory, the pressure inside the plastic zone is equal to the top pressure. In this case, from the perspective of optimal force performance, circular support should be adopted. However, the actual measurement proves that the lateral pressure in the plastic medium is generally slightly less than the top pressure, and it is possible to design an elliptical or elliptical lane.
In the stratified roadway in the mining area, due to the particularly large pressure of the mining site, the application of a flexible circular stone support in the mine of Suzhou China Kaolin Company has been successful, and no mortar is needed for the stone support. 1~1.5cm thick wood block, after the support, due to the compressibility of the wooden block, the peak pressure of the ground is consumed in the deformation energy of the support, so that the ground pressure is stabilized. At home and abroad, there are also areas with particularly large ground pressure. A prefabricated prefabricated piece of concrete prefabricated or reinforced concrete is used with such flexible support, but not with a stone.
China's kaolin mining technology Open-pit mining mines are small in scale and are excavated by hand or wind. The narrow-gauge railway is used for transportation. Because the mine car is short, it can be loaded by manual loading, and the stripping is still carried out by rock blasting. The original Suzhou Chinese kaolin The shallow mining of the Yangdong and Yangxi mining areas affiliated to the company has been used. Large-scale mine ore is directly excavated by excavators, such as WK-2 excavator for Fujian Longyan Mine and WY-32 electro-hydraulic excavator for Zhanjiang Hawthorn Mine. After digging, it is loaded into the dump truck and sent to the concentrator, such as the 17t dump truck used in Fujian Longyan Mine and the 10t dump truck used in Zhanjiang Mountain Mine. Rock rock blasting method for hard rock stripping, for example, the Longjing Mine CLQ-80A crawler type Drilling Rock Drilling Rock, ammonium nitrate explosive blasting, and then loaded with dump trucks by excavator to the dumping site. Peeling of the topsoil, excavator backhoe excavation and loading are also useful for bulldozers to collect the pile first, and then use the excavator to load the car. Sandy kaolin can be used in water and water transportation, such as Guangdong Maoming Kaolin Company and Guangdong Maoming South Kaolin Company. The water resources are rich and the water is abundant. Water delivery. The ore is washed by a water gun, and the slurry passes through the rushing ditch to the collecting tank. The slurry pool is arranged in the middle of the nugget, one for each nugget. The pulp conveying pump is transported to the roughing plant through a 250 mm diameter plastic pipe. The technical performance of the water gun is shown in Table 4.22.21. The water recovery and transportation of kaolin mines is also used in the UK. Its main advantages are: simple mining process, simple equipment and high labor productivity. The pulping process of the concentrator is carried out in advance, and the selection and integration are integrated. The peeling of the upper cover is dry stripping.
Underground mining mines such as the various mines affiliated to Suzhou China Kaolin Company and the Qingshan Baimu Mine in Wu County, according to the characteristics of soft and thick ore bodies, have been using stratified caving for many years, each layer from the roof to the floor, from the mining boundary or mine The block boundary is arranged to the ore discharge patio to be retracted and returned. The area of ​​the ore block is controlled at 800 to 1 000 m2, and the mining time per layer is 3 to 4 months, which can reduce the maintenance of the roadway. After the stratified mining, considering the formation of the regenerated roof, it is necessary to stop for 1 to 2 months and then mine the next layer, as shown in Figure 4.22.8. When mining, there is no need for blasting method, but with wind and handcuffs. Foreign countries can use the scraper to pick up the automatic machine along the way to carry out the mining. The marble of the kaolinite base contains pure nitrogen, which will be ejected from the crack during tunneling. Therefore, the problem of diluting nitrogen should be considered in the calculation of air volume. Precautionary measures should be taken to quickly determine the air content of the working surface and set up an automatic alarm device. Choose a good mixed ventilation method. Regarding the problem of caving, it is also more specific than the mine that generally uses the stratified caving method. Generally, mines with stratified caving method are used to form pits on the surface, accumulating rainwater and surface water, and the working face is water-spraying. The surface of the kaolin mine also forms pits and accumulates water, but the regeneration of residual minerals left after mining is topped. Water expansion can function as a water barrier, and there is very little water in the working face. However, sometimes the ore release makes the regenerative roof loose, and the uneven sinking will cause the upper accumulated water to rush out of the mud. This kind of accident has occurred frequently. Therefore, the kaolin mine must take comprehensive waterproof measures against the collapse of the surface and pay attention to the problem of caving and caving.
